CLN v26.06 deprecates getroute in favor of askrene's getroutes. Replace the Dowser's getroute+listchannels loop (up to ~40 RPC round-trips) with a single getroutes call and let askrene's min-cost-flow solver enumerate multi-path capacity directly. Response parsing follows the getroutes schema; 205/206 (no route / too expensive) maps to zero capacity. Size the probe to the caller's threshold. The Dowser is a flow estimator: callers compare the dowsed flow against a channel size (the janitor and preinvestigator min-channel acceptance test, the channel creator's sizing). A fixed probe amount caps the estimate, so any threshold at or above that cap rejects every candidate regardless of real capacity. RequestDowser now carries a min_amount; callers that test against a channel size set it, and the probe runs at min_amount / reserve_factor so a full-flow result clears the threshold for any configured channel size. The channel creator dowses at max-channel so new channels size toward the operator ceiling instead of being pinned at the min-channel floor. The manual clboss-dowser command keeps the fixed default probe.
